Investing in the Polish stock exchange is probably the best you can do. It is true that a non-trivial part of the Polish economy is controlled by foreign companies but these tend to be large international companies so you could invest in them but only into the global company and not just the part of the company that covers Poland.
As a random example, look at supermarket/ retail chains (source). The biggest ones are Polish (although some of them may also have stores in other countries) but Lidl, Aldi (Germany), Netto (Denmark), Spar (Netherlands) or Carrefour (France) are also major players on the Polish market. Of course you can invest in any of these but you can't specifically invest only into the part of them that covers the Polish market.
